Zathapek Was a Hero of the Communist Regime
Zathapek pioneered the idea of high volume high intensity interval training for distance runners and he trained with a level of severity that was considered completely insane at the time. Zathapek was fluent in eight languages and spoke lots of others. He was a hero of the communist regime in Czechoslovakia but it turns out he was a much more complex person than that.
